List defaults consistently in manpage

Nearly everywhere, we end options with "(Default: foo)".  But in a
few places, we inserted an extra period after or before the close
parenthesis, and in a few other places we said "(Defaults to foo)".
Let's not do that.

If true, Tor does not believe any anonymously retrieved DNS answer that
tells it that an address resolves to an internal address (like 127.0.0.1 or
192.168.0.1). This option prevents certain browser-based attacks; don't
turn it off unless you know what you're doing. (Default: 1).
turn it off unless you know what you're doing. (Default: 1)

**ServerDNSSearchDomains** **0**|**1**::
If set to 1, then we will search for addresses in the local search domain.
For example, if this system is configured to believe it is in
"example.com", and a client tries to connect to "www", the client will be
connected to "www.example.com". This option only affects name lookups that
your server does on behalf of clients. (Defaults to "0".)
your server does on behalf of clients. (Default: 0)
